Lam, Thomas Quantized dual graded graphs. (English) Zbl 1230.05163 Electron. J. Comb. 17, No. 1, Research Paper R88, 11 p. (2010). Summary: We study quantized dual graded graphs, which are graphs equipped with linear operators satisfying the relation \(DU - qU D = rI\). We construct examples based upon: the Fibonacci differential poset, permutations, standard Young tableau, and plane binary trees.
